
Sweatiquette. Helpful Tips
Unhurried enjoyment, quiet voices and consideration for others are the cornerstones of sauna etiquette.

suggestions to sweat by ...
- Relax. Breathe evenly.
- Sweating and flushed skin are perfectly normal BUT Listen to your body and trust your senses. Drink plenty of water. If the sauna feels too hot, take a few minutes to “air bathe” outside your sauna.
- Keep water bottles outside of your sauna door. Glass bottles are ok to bring in with you if you enjoy drinking hot water!
- Refrain from applying oil, lotion, perfume or any other products to your skin prior to entering the sauna for your sweat session. Makeup should be removed; you still look beautiful.
- Wear your “Birthday Suit” during your session BUT please cover thyself when walking through the public parts of our boutique.
- Jewelry and eyeglasses should be left at home or out of the sauna. Metal jewelry may get hot in the sauna. We are not responsible for lost pieces.
- Your “indoor voice” is greatly appreciated by all our other guests.
